Writing & Presenting Legal Advice To Your Clients
Clear, confident communication is essential for delivering legal advice that clients understand, trust and can act upon.
This practical one‑day course helps you refine your writing and presenting skills, focusing on plain English, clarity, structure and professional delivery. Through hands‑on exercises, worked examples and live presentation practice, you will learn how to communicate legal advice in a client‑friendly, accessible and persuasive way.

How is training delivered?
We know that every learner is different. We have a range of study modes which suit a variety of study styles, commitments and preferences.
Online Classroom Live offers a host of benefits to support your learning in the following ways:
Interactive features replicate a real-life classroom to keep you fully engaged
Course notes are shared by your tutor highlighting points and sharing knowledge
You will regularly share your opinions and ask questions via instant live chat messaging and contribute to class polls
Work with fellow learners in smaller group breakout rooms
Access course materials and a recording of your live online session after it has taken place
